DH> I went to school with a person and his last name was Houghton. He 
DH> pronounced it Hoe-ton.
DH> Within the past year or two, I have heard other families pronounce it How-ten.

England has got three villages called Houghton and they're all
pronounced differently :)

That said, my opinion is that most brits looking at that
word would pronounce it orton, as in bought or brought. Most towns
ending in oughton seem to be pronounced ..orton.

But then Okeford Fitzpaine in Dorset is pronounced "fippeny ockford."

Lovely language, innit?
